Kiplinger’s May issue of Personal Finance magazine presents a list of the top ten areas in the USA with the highest percentage of millionaire households. This list was compiled from a variety of sources to identify those households with a net worth of at least a million dollars, exclusive of their primary residence. Three of the top ten are in Florida. No other state had more than one!
For comparison, only eight percent of households nationwide are in the millionaire class. Of the above three areas, Vero Beach and surroundings offers significantly lower median home prices.
Okay, you’ve been dying to know what took the number one spot in this survey. Unbelievably, it was Los Alamos, New Mexico! One in five households there are in the millionaire category. It, of course, is the site of several government laboratories employing many highly paid scientists. That fact accounts for its high rank.
